Recovery readiness scoring combines multiple data inputs — sleep quality, HRV, subjective wellness, and training load history — into a single readiness metric that guides training intensity decisions. AI wellness tools that produce readiness scores allow for daily training calibration based on actual physiological state. This concept covers readiness scoring as a data integration approach to training-recovery management.
Recovery readiness scoring is a method AI tools use to estimate how prepared your body is for training stress on any given day, drawing on inputs like sleep quality, resting heart rate, mood, and recent workout load. Unlike static rest-day schedules, it dynamically flags when your system needs more recovery time before adding new stress.
For anyone trying to train consistently without burning out or getting injured, this concept turns vague feelings of fatigue into structured, actionable signals that AI can interpret and act on. It makes the kind of nuanced daily check-in that elite coaches provide accessible to anyone with a smartphone and a good prompt.
Each morning, prompt ChatGPT or Claude with a short readiness report: 'My sleep was 5.5 hours, HRV was lower than usual, and my legs feel heavy. I planned a hard leg day. Score my recovery readiness and suggest whether I should train as planned, scale back, or substitute a different session.'
